    Hi, I am reaching out because I’m at my final straw with this company. I purchased hot air balloon ride back in April 2023 for my anniversary present to my boyfriend. It got canceled twice due to weather and we were not able to make another date the whole summer so I decided to ask for a refund. Their policy is as long as its within the 6 months you purchased the flight then you get a full refund. So I have been requesting my money back from them since July / august of 2023. I have called and left multiple voicemails and wrote various emails. I did not screen shot all of them as I thought it would be an easy process. But once time started going by and I didnt get my money back I started documenting. I lost my wallet after booking the initial flight and they cannot refund my account since I got a new credit card so they said they would mail a check. Ive been waiting since august for the check and they dont answer me back and I have not received it yet. The last time I spoke with someone 2 weeks ago they claimed it was sent back to them and before that said they forgot to mail it. I think theyre waiting until my 6months is over so they can keep my money. Nobody will return my calls or emails and I just want my $450 back. Thats a lot of money to just let go. Ive been nice and patient until this point. This month will be that 6 month window and I still dont have my check yet from July. Can somebody please help me.

    We had a balloon ride scheduled for 10/26/2022 that was cancelled due to weather. Understandable, as it was rainy. I called later that day to request a refund because their next availability wasn't for two weeks, and we were leaving the area in 3 days. They said it takes 7-10 business days to receive a refund. It has been 15 business days, no refund. I've called and left 3 messages, and no call backs. We paid a total of $583.00.

    On 9/17/22, my husband and I attended the Lancaster Balloon Festival and Country Fair. We paid $30 each for admission, so $60 total via credit card. We expected to see the 40+ hot air balloons that were advertised on their website, ******** page, *********, fliers, and on the event program that was handed out at admission. The mass accession was scheduled for 5:30 pm. There was an announcement that the weather conditions were not appropriate for flight. By 6:00 pm, only 4 balloons inflated and launched. Another balloon inflated and offered "tethered balloon rides." My husband and I waited until 8 pm for the hot air balloon glow. At which time only one other balloon inflated in the field. We would never want anyone to get hurt due to flying in unsafe conditions. But, at the very least , they could have inflated a few more balloons- even if they didn't leave the ground. And understandably so, if they were not going to inflate anymore balloons, they could have at least offered a voucher or refund or something.It was like paying to get into the zoo, hoping to see lions, giraffes, and elephants, and only seeing one pigeon, one cat, and one squirrel. We feel as though the advertisements were misleading and deceitful. We also feel as though the service was not delivered in it's entirety as described and we should be issued a refund.We have attempted to reach the organizers of the events via ******** message, ********* message and phone call. No message or phone call has been returned up until this point. The first message we sent was on Sunday, 9/18. It's now Wednesday, 9/21.
